Description

The Mas de La Chapelle was once a Priory of the Order of Knights of Malta, s built in the 16th century on a small hill in the Arlesian countryside. Repurchased in the year 2000 by a Franco-Swiss interior designer and art historian, the Mas de la Chapelle has been completely renovated and transformed into a small hôtel de charme in the spirit of bed & breakfast. The establishment offers fourteen rooms, each having a particular character. The Chapelle has been metamorphosed into a large baroque hall and the adjacent building has three large rooms on the second floor, with the reception area and breakfast room located on the ground floor. Near the central building are the Red House, accommodating four rooms giving on to a terrace, the Pool Patio, which has six rooms, and the Turret House, which has one room, known as the "chambre des Amoureux".
